    My son is a freshman and so far, we have been very pleased with St. Francis High School. The…read moreteachers appear to be very dedicated to their jobs, and the students seem to all get along well. We also really like the after school tutorial; all the teachers have to stay after school for 1 hour to assist students with homework. So far so good! Unfortunately, we did end up switching schools but not because of the educational environment (which I felt was good), but rather the inconvenience of the drive! It was too far from our home in Santa Cruz, and they don't have an after school bus for their sports programs, which meant I or my husband had to pick up our son on a daily basis. I would like to add that when you choose a private school you are choosing an environment that is more conducive to learning, in the sense that there are little to no behavioral distractions in the classroom. This is essentially what you are paying for. If such a student does exist, she or he will not last long for expulsion is at the discrepancy of the administration, and they do not tolerate said distractions. At a private school, you are not paying for "better teachers" but rather teachers whose instruction is uninterrupted. This flow does allow your student to learn at a faster pace, which in turn does give your student the opportunity to learn more.
